Latest Patents
Agisilaos holds a patent for a "Flow control module and method for controlling the flow in a hydronic system." This invention involves a hydronic system that includes a primary side with a first port connected to a source element output and a second port connected to a source element input. It features a controllable primary side flow actuator that provides a primary side flow. Additionally, the system has a secondary side with a third port connected to a load element input and a fourth port connected to a load element output, along with a controllable secondary side flow actuator. The flow control module adapts the thermal power transfer of a transfer element by controlling the flow actuators to minimize deviations in thermal power transfer.
